## Quartzline Environments: Cron Drift Investigation

During the March audit we found that Quartzline's staging scheduler drifted 47 seconds per day relative to production, causing overlapping batch windows. Root cause traced to a stale NTP peer list baked into the staging image. Both environments have since been repinned. For verification, the current scheduler configuration for each environment is listed below.

settings of tagag-kawep:
OLIAEL_HOST=oliael.zemvarsys.internal
OLIAEL_PORT=5672

Welcome aboard. This is the weekly release note for FeedCheck, our podcast feed validator at Larkwhistle Media. Version 2.4 adds stricter enclosure-size checks and better handling of malformed pubDate fields. Nothing in this build changes the CLI flags, so existing scripts on the Penhallow servers should run unmodified. Staging validation passed overnight; the full regression suite finished clean this morning. If you see failures, flag them in the release channel before Thursday. The trace token for this build follows.

build token for fajep-yajof: htk9_7d88c0238

**Ticket: Reminder job double-sends**

The Willowbrook Clinic reminder job (Pingwell batch) occasionally fires twice when the retry queue drains late. Fix adds an idempotency key per appointment per day. Tested on staging with simulated delays — looks clean. Needs a sign-off before we ship Thursday. The person who needs to approve this is below.

account owner for bawip-tahag: Raleth Quenok

## Formula sandbox tuning

User-supplied formulas in Gridmoor execute inside a restricted interpreter with hard ceilings on time, memory, and call depth. Reviewers should confirm any change to these ceilings is justified in the PR description, since raising them widens the abuse surface. Defaults were chosen from production traces. The current limits are as follows.

limits module of tafog-fawip:
WEIGHTS = {
    "julix": 57,
    "lamys": 992,
    "kasvan": 209,
    "quenok": 750,
    "alddor": 259,
    "oliath": 1009,
    "wenix": 815,
}